This Thursday, May 8, is our pork roast dinner. We start serving at 5 p.m. and the cost is only $5 per person. You don’t have to be a senior or a member to join us for any of our meals. We will be more than happy to have you join us. Try it you might like it.

The following Thursday, May 15 is the day of the AARP Safe Driving Course. We still have room, so give us a call at (406) 676-2371, if you want to sign up for it.

Cards will be played here at the Ronan Center on May 19, at 7 p.m. The Foot Clinic will be here on Wednesday, May 21, from 10 a.m. until noon. Call us if you want your name on the list. There are no appointments, as it is on a “first come, first served” basis.

The menu is as follows: 

Wednesday, May 7: ham and noodle casserole

Thursday, May 8: pork roast

Friday, May 9: potato bar

Monday, May 12: chicken enchiladas

Wednesday, May 14: barbecue ribs 

Friday, May 16: tater tot casserole.

We serve meals at noon on Monday, Wednesday and Friday. The cost of these meals is only $4 if you are 60 or older and $5 if you are younger.
